How about EMI's Central Research Laboratories down the road at Hayes.  They had quite a complex of buildings, all dated around this time.  EMI didn't just make vinyl records, the research and development wing designed microphones, radar, medical CAT Scan machines, guided missiles, computers and televisions.

I have not been able to find pictures of the labs, but maybe someone local to the area may have a thought.

I cannot find a picture but wonder if it was the National Chemical Laboratory at Teddington mentioned here
http://www.emeraldinsight.com/doi/abs/10.1108/eb019532

This establishment had been inaugurated several years previously as a separate D.S.I.R. station situated in the same grounds as the National Physical Laboratory. Quite recently it has achieved the status of National Chemical Laboratory
